The Plapcea is a right tributary of the river Vedea in Romania.[1][2] It discharges into the Vedea in Icoana.[3] The following towns and villages are situated along the river Plapcea, from source to mouth: Constantinești, Mogoșești, Jitaru, Potcoava, Fălcoeni, Sinești and Icoana. Its length is 56 km (35 mi) and its basin size is 354 km2 (137 sq mi).[2]
